1. Understanding FMCG Market Dynamics
The FMCG market is unique due to its high volume, low-cost products, and frequent purchases. Key characteristics include:
- High Purchase Frequency: FMCG products like toiletries, snacks, and cleaning agents are bought regularly.
- Low Margins: Profit margins are low, so volume sales are essential.
- Mass Target Audience: Products target a wide range of demographics.
- Brand Loyalty: Branding plays a significant role in repeat purchases.
Understanding these dynamics is crucial to designing effective digital marketing strategies.

3. Key Digital Marketing Strategies for FMCG Products
Here are the most effective strategies for FMCG brands in the digital space:
3.1 Search Engine Optimization (SEO)
SEO ensures your FMCG brand ranks higher on Google and other search engines. Strategies include:
- Keyword research for product-related searches
- Optimizing product pages with meta tags, descriptions, and images
- Creating blog content to answer customer queries
Example: A snack brand creating blog posts like “Top 10 Healthy Snacks for Kids” to attract organic traffic.
3.2 Social Media Marketing
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, and TikTok are powerful for FMCG brands.
- Share engaging content, contests, and product launches
- Collaborate with influencers to reach niche audiences
- Use Stories, Reels, and live sessions for interactive marketing
Example: A personal care brand collaborating with beauty influencers to showcase new products.

4. Role of E-commerce in FMCG Digital Marketing
E-commerce platforms have become crucial for FMCG sales. Brands can:
- Sell products directly via Amazon, Flipkart, or brand websites
- Offer subscriptions or bundles for regular consumption
- Leverage analytics to track sales trends and customer preferences
Example: A beverage company offering subscription-based deliveries of flavored drinks via their online store.
5. Case Studies of Successful FMCG Digital Marketing
Case 1: Coca-Cola
- Engages consumers through social media campaigns and hashtags
- Personalized bottles for campaigns like “Share a Coke”
Case 2: Unilever
- Uses influencer marketing and interactive content for brands like Dove
- Focuses on value-based storytelling
Case 3: Amul
- Known for witty social media posts related to current events
- Builds strong online engagement and brand recall
6. Challenges in Digital Marketing for FMCG Products
While digital marketing offers advantages, it comes with challenges:
- High Competition: Many brands compete for attention online
- Short Product Lifespan: FMCG products often have seasonal demand
- Consumer Trust: Digital campaigns must balance promotion and authenticity
- Data Privacy: Handling consumer data responsibly is critical
